Default Camber adjustment?

I have a 00 dak sport 2wd and I was looking at my front end the other day and noticed that I have a negative camber. It's not too horrible but I don't want to mess up my tread or anything. Is there a way to adjust the camber on these trucks? Any help would be much appreciated. Thanks.

I wouldn't mess with the camber setting unless you have access to a front end alignment machine. With these trucks, if you adjust camber, you will throw off your caster which will cause a pull in your steering wheel. Your best bet, get a 4 wheel alignment from a reputable service facility.
